interface PositioningOptions {
    /**
     * Whether styles applied by the positioning utility should be restored on cleanup.
     */
    restoreStyles?: boolean | undefined;
    /**
     * Whether to apply computed position styles (`--x`, `--y`, `--z-index`) to the floating element.
     * Set to `false` when the consumer applies these from context (e.g. for exit animations).
     * @default true
     */
    applyStyles?: boolean | undefined;
    /**
     * Whether the popover should be hidden when the reference element is detached
     */
    hideWhenDetached?: boolean | undefined;
    /**
     * The strategy to use for positioning
     */
    strategy?: "absolute" | "fixed" | undefined;
    /**
     * The initial placement of the floating element
     */
    placement?: Placement | undefined;
    /**
     * The offset of the floating element
     */
    offset?: {
        mainAxis?: number | undefined;
        crossAxis?: number | undefined;
    } | undefined;
    /**
     * The main axis offset or gap between the reference and floating elements
     */
    gutter?: number | undefined;
    /**
     * The secondary axis offset or gap between the reference and floating elements
     */
    shift?: number | undefined;
    /**
     * The virtual padding around the viewport edges to check for overflow
     */
    overflowPadding?: number | undefined;
    /**
     * The minimum padding between the arrow and the floating element's corner.
     * @default 4
     */
    arrowPadding?: number | undefined;
    /**
     * Whether to flip the placement
     */
    flip?: boolean | Placement[] | undefined;
    /**
     * Whether the popover should slide when it overflows.
     */
    slide?: boolean | undefined;
    /**
     * Whether the floating element can overlap the reference element
     * @default false
     */
    overlap?: boolean | undefined;
    /**
     * Whether to make the floating element same width as the reference element
     */
    sameWidth?: boolean | undefined;
    /**
     * Whether the popover should fit the viewport.
     */
    fitViewport?: boolean | undefined;
    /**
     * Whether to use the size middleware from Floating UI.
     * It computes and sets CSS variables (`--reference-width`, `--reference-height`, `--available-width`, `--available-height`) used by `sameWidth` and `fitViewport`.
     *
     * Disabling it improves scroll performance with heavy content by avoiding layout thrashing on each update.
     * Only applies when both `sameWidth` and `fitViewport` are false — the middleware is always used when either is enabled.
     * @default true
     */
    sizeMiddleware?: boolean | undefined;
    /**
     * The overflow boundary of the reference element
     * Accepts a function returning a Boundary, a Boundary directly,
     * or the shorthand string 'clipping-ancestors' which maps to Floating UI's 'clippingAncestors'.
     */
    boundary?: (() => Boundary) | Boundary | "clipping-ancestors" | undefined;
    /**
     * Options to activate auto-update listeners
     */
    listeners?: boolean | AutoUpdateOptions | undefined;
    /**
     * Function called when the placement is computed
     */
    onComplete?: ((data: ComputePositionReturn) => void) | undefined;
    /**
     * Function called when the floating element is positioned or not
     */
    onPositioned?: ((data: {
        placed: boolean;
    }) => void) | undefined;
    /**
     * Function that returns the anchor element.
     * Useful when you want to use a different element as the anchor.
     */
    getAnchorElement?: (() => HTMLElement | VirtualElement | null) | undefined;
    /**
     *  Function that returns the anchor rect
     * @deprecated Use `getAnchorElement` instead
     */
    getAnchorRect?: ((element: HTMLElement | VirtualElement | null) => AnchorRect | null) | undefined;
    /**
     * A callback that will be called when the popover needs to calculate its
     * position.
     */
    updatePosition?: ((data: {
        updatePosition: () => Promise<void>;
        floatingElement: HTMLElement | null;
    }) => void | Promise<void>) | undefined;
}
